From ee15de014ecfc780c8bd86e00eb8b24bf6149db9 Mon Sep 17 00:00:00 2001 From: Jules Laplace Date: Thu, 19 Nov 2015 18:20:33 -0500 Subject: stub in ordersview --- StoneIsland/www/js/lib/_router.js | 1 + StoneIsland/www/js/lib/account/OrdersView.js | 4 ++++ StoneIsland/www/js/lib/nav/NavView.js | 10 ++++++++++ 3 files changed, 15 insertions(+) create mode 100644 StoneIsland/www/js/lib/account/OrdersView.js (limited to 'StoneIsland/www/js/lib') diff --git a/StoneIsland/www/js/lib/_router.js b/StoneIsland/www/js/lib/_router.js index 20ef2ce1..80ea9c39 100644 --- a/StoneIsland/www/js/lib/_router.js +++ b/StoneIsland/www/js/lib/_router.js @@ -19,6 +19,7 @@ var SiteRouter = Router.extend({ '/account/profile': 'profile', '/account/payment': 'payment', '/account/shipping': 'shipping', + '/account/orders': 'orders', '/account/settings': 'settings', '/page/terms': 'terms', diff --git a/StoneIsland/www/js/lib/account/OrdersView.js b/StoneIsland/www/js/lib/account/OrdersView.js new file mode 100644 index 00000000..f269b7cf --- /dev/null +++ b/StoneIsland/www/js/lib/account/OrdersView.js @@ -0,0 +1,4 @@ +var OrdersView = ScrollableView.extend({ + + +}) diff --git a/StoneIsland/www/js/lib/nav/NavView.js b/StoneIsland/www/js/lib/nav/NavView.js index 2145c163..1a519de7 100644 --- a/StoneIsland/www/js/lib/nav/NavView.js +++ b/StoneIsland/www/js/lib/nav/NavView.js @@ -19,6 +19,8 @@ var NavView = View.extend({ "click .payment": "payment", "click .shipping": "shipping", "click .settings": "settings", + "click .orders": "orders", + "click .return_link": "return_link", "click .faq_back": "back", "click .privacy": "privacy", @@ -96,10 +98,18 @@ var NavView = View.extend({ this.hide() app.router.go("account/shipping") }, + orders: function(){ + this.hide() + app.router.go("account/orders") + }, settings: function(){ this.hide() app.router.go("account/settings") }, + return_link: function(){ + window.open("http://www.stoneisland.com/", '_system') + }, + faq: function(){ this.el.className = "faq" -- cgit v1.2.3-70-g09d2